Neglecting Ventilation Demands
While numerous home owners concentrate on the visual and architectural elements of roofing installment, neglecting ventilation requirements can bring about serious lasting repercussions. https://beaugbvqk.answerblogs.com/34156824/disregarding-roof-covering-air-flow-can-incur-high-prices-in-repairs-recognize-the-essential-variables-that-make-certain-proper-installation-and-safeguard-your-monetary-interests is necessary for regulating temperature level and dampness levels in your attic, avoiding problems like mold growth, wood rot, and ice dams. If you do not install sufficient air flow, you're setting your roof up for failing.
To avoid this mistake, initially, examine your home's specific air flow needs. A balanced system usually consists of both consumption and exhaust vents to advertise air movement. Guarantee you have actually set up soffit vents along the eaves and ridge vents at the height of your roofing system. This mix enables hot air to run away while cooler air gets in, keeping your attic room comfy.
Likewise, take into consideration the kind of roofing product you have actually chosen. Some products may need added ventilation approaches. Confirm your regional building codes for ventilation guidelines, as they can differ significantly.
Ultimately, don't neglect to examine your air flow system on a regular basis. Obstructions from particles or insulation can restrain air flow, so maintain those vents clear.
